investigation of xylene permeability as pesticides and herbicides solvent in cylindrical plastic bottles

The permeability of agrochemical contents through typical plastic bottle walls has been investigated. there were four different formulations of abamectin used in this study, consisting of 1.8% abamectin as sample 1, 3.6% abamectin as sample 2, 0% abamectin as sample 3 (just containing abamectin solvent system and emulsifier), and 1.8% abamectin with double emulsifier as sample 4. the pesticide composition had a significant effect on multi-layer plastic bottle wall permeability at room temperature. the maximum permeability is related to sample 3 at 54°c with a mass flux of 0.21 gr/m2.day. the mass flux of sample 3 was about 3.7 times higher at 54°c compared to room temperature. since xylene is the main solvent of pesticides (i.e. abamectin), it was selected as a migrating component in all types of bottles. the main experiments in the second step have been done with thick pet (0.9 mm thickness), ordinary pet bottles (0.35 mm thickness), single-layer pe, co-extruded pe bottles with different barrier layers including evoh, pa6, and pa6/6.6 co-polymer. for 45 days and 54°c, the evoh-based bottle has the least permeability compared to the other bottles with a mass flux of 0.25 gr/m2.day. the pa6 and pa6/6.6-based bottles in the same condition have 5% and 65% more xylene permeability, respectively. thick pet bottles, the single-layer pe bottle and ordinary pet were not suitable for xylene maintenance and collapsed after a few days.
